THE OBJECT:
The object of Reflection is to determine which line of axis to place the mirror to achieve the most sphere points BEFORE the mirror is actually placed.

Note:  The playing field contains many lines of axes.  Along any of these lines of axes the mirror could be placed.

GAME PLAY:
1.   First, a card is placed on the rotating base and the colored spheres are studied for point value, points described later. (Mirror is not used yet).
2.   Next, players use their colored peg to mark the axis where the mirror will be placed to achieve the highest score. (The mirror still not used.)
3.   Then, players take turns placing the mirror along the axis they chose to assess the points they've earned.
4.   Finally, the points are recorded.

SCORING (Easy. Easy. Nothing intimidating here):

RED & BLUE Spheres
Key:  Always subtract the lesser color from the greater color. 
For example:
5 Red, 3 Blue = Score of 2
5 Blue, 3 Red = Score of 2
4 Red, 4 Blue = Score 0
3 Red, 0 Blue = Score 3

GREEN Spheres
Always add one point for each Green sphere

YELLOW Spheres
Always subtract one point for each Yellow sphere

Reflection was created by famed puzzle writer, author and inventor, Ivan Moscovich - which heightened our curiosity and the game's credibility too. Ivan Moscovich was founder of the first Museum of Science & Technology in Israel in 1964. Enthusiasm for Ivan’s concept of an “interactive museum” circled the globe. San Francisco’s Exploratorium science museum opened in 1969 with exhibits for visitor interaction, including Ivan’s artistic mathematical conceptions. We do like Ivan.
